Are there any special mortgage programs for first-time homebuyers in Vincentown, NJ?

Yes, New Jersey offers several statewide programs that are accessible in Vincentown, such as the NJHMFA First-Time Homebuyer Mortgage Program, which provides competitive fixed-rate loans with down payment assistance. Additionally, Burlington County may offer local grants or programs, so it's wise to consult with a local lender familiar with the area's specific offerings to maximize your benefits.

How do property taxes in Vincentown, NJ, affect my mortgage qualification and payments?

Burlington County, where Vincentown is located, has property tax rates that are significant and must be factored into your debt-to-income ratio. Lenders will include these estimated taxes in your monthly escrow payment, which can be a substantial portion of your total mortgage payment. It's crucial to get an accurate tax estimate for your specific property, as this can impact how much home you can afford.

What is the typical down payment needed for a home in Vincentown's market?

While 20% down is standard to avoid private mortgage insurance (PMI), many buyers in Vincentown utilize conventional loans with 3-5% down or FHA loans with 3.5% down, especially given the area's mix of suburban and rural properties. For the many first-time and moderate-income buyers in the region, state and county down payment assistance programs can further reduce this initial cash requirement.

Are USDA loans a viable option for homes in Vincentown, NJ?

Yes, absolutely. Much of the area surrounding the Vincentown village center in Southampton Township is classified as rural by the USDA. This makes eligible properties qualify for USDA Rural Development loans, which offer 100% financing (no down payment) to moderate-income buyers—a fantastic option for purchasing a home on larger lots common in the area.

How does Vincentown's location within the Pinelands National Reserve influence the mortgage process?

Properties in or near the Pinelands may be subject to specific development restrictions and environmental regulations. Lenders may require specialized inspections or be more cautious with appraisals for unique properties. It's essential to work with a local real estate agent and lender who understand these nuances to ensure there are no surprises that could delay or derail your mortgage approval.

Finding Your Financing Fit: A Guide to Private Mortgage Lenders in Vincentown, NJ

Searching for "private mortgage lenders near me" in Vincentown is more than just looking for an alternative to big banks. It's about finding a flexible financing partner who understands the unique character of our local market. Vincentown, with its blend of historic homes, newer developments, and spacious rural properties, presents opportunities that sometimes fall outside the strict guidelines of traditional lenders. Whether you're eyeing a charming fixer-upper on Main Street or a property with unique acreage, private mortgage lenders can be a key piece of the puzzle.

So, what exactly are private lenders, and why consider them in Vincentown? These are typically individuals or smaller companies that use their own funds or investor capital to make loans. They operate with more flexibility than large institutions, which can be crucial for properties that need work, for self-employed buyers with complex income, or for situations requiring a very fast closing. In a competitive market, the ability to move quickly with a solid financing commitment can make all the difference in securing your dream home.

For Vincentown homebuyers, here are some practical tips. First, understand that private loans often come with different terms, including potentially higher interest rates or shorter loan periods. They are frequently used as a bridge—to purchase a property you intend to renovate and then refinance, or to close quickly before securing long-term financing. Always work with a reputable local real estate attorney to review any private lending agreement; this is non-negotiable in New Jersey's complex real estate landscape.

While exploring private options, don't overlook New Jersey-specific programs that might also help. The NJHMFA offers first-time homebuyer programs with competitive rates and down payment assistance. A private lender might be the solution if you don't quite fit those criteria but still need a path to homeownership in Southampton Township.

Your actionable first step is to leverage your local network. Speak with experienced Vincentown real estate agents. They often have connections to trusted private lenders who have successfully financed deals in our area. Attend local township meetings or community events; word-of-mouth referrals are gold in a close-knit community like ours. Finally, be prepared. Approach a private lender with a clear plan: a solid budget, a realistic timeline for the property (like repairs or refinancing), and a good understanding of your property's value post-renovation.

Finding the right financing in Vincentown is about matching the solution to the property and your personal circumstances. By understanding the role of private lenders and doing your due diligence, you can unlock possibilities and plant roots in our special corner of Burlington County.
